How much does it cost to rent an apartment in The Mills?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| The Mills 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,388 | $975 | $2,001 |
| The Mills 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,634 | $1,207 | $2,635 |
The Mills 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,653 | $1,491 | $1,975 |
| The Mills 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,654 | $1,653 | $1,656 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om The Mills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om The Mills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in The Mills is $1,653.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om The Mills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in The Mills is a 1,350 square feet unit starting from $1,700 at ConcordView Townhomes.
What is the average size for The Mills 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in The Mills is currently 1,298 sq ft.
